Overview

A malignant tumor of the lowest part of the uterus (womb) that can be prevented by PAP smear screening and a HPV vaccine. There may be no symptoms. In a few cases, there may be irregular bleeding or pain. Treatments include surgery, radiation, and chemotherapy.
